THE RESULTS OF THE STUDY: • Boys tended to be play more violent video games and had a higher baseline of aggressive behaviour • Violent video games had a more significant influence on young children than it did on older children, although both groups were still affected • Surprisingly, parental involvement in the media habits of children were not a significant moderating effect TEN MINUTES WITH PROFESSOR ANDERSON • Prior aggression did not actually moderate nor predict future aggressive behaviour; as long as the child played violent video games, he or she tended to display more aggressive behaviour, contradicting the popular belief that video game violence only affects people who are already highly aggressive What were the differences in violent behaviour, if any, between the boys and the girls who were in the recent study? As is usually found in such studies, boys reported higher levels of physical aggression than did girls. Boys also reported higher levels of violent video game play than girls. However, the most important finding regarding gender was that the link between violent video game play and later aggressive thoughts and aggressive behaviour was essentially the same for boys and girls. That is, boys and girls were affected in the same way by violent video games. There also is some evidence that playing games that glorify criminal activities increase later cheating or stealing behaviours. In the TV violence literature, there is evidence that showing harmful consequences of the violent behaviour influences the short term effects on viewers’ aggressive behaviour. Furthermore, there is evidence that punishing in-game violence by taking away points reduces in-game violence and later aggressive behaviour. Do children who are regularly exposed to violent video games and television shows grow up to become more aggressive adults? Yes, it is now clear that frequent childhood exposure to violent media leads to more aggressive adults. There also are a few studies that suggest that this effect can be reduced by reducing violent media exposure, and possibly by increasing exposure to pro-social media. The study showed that the rate or frequency of reported aggressive behaviour was lower in the older adolescents. This is not surprising, because this age trend occurs in all major studies that track aggression across time and age. Of course, the ability to inflict more serious harm also increases as children get bigger, stronger, and more skilled in fighting and using weapons. On the second question, our data contradicted the idea that older children and adolescents are immune to media violence effects. In fact, our data showed that the effect of violent video game play on later aggressive behaviour was essentially the same at younger and older ages.
